A list of Kevin and Molly's ditch flowers:

Trees: Willow, Smoke Cherry, Weeping Pussy Willow, Peach 

Bulbs: Summer Lily, Tulips, Hyacinths, Imperial Fritillary, Ox Eye Daisies, Red Poppies, Danish Flag Poppies, Bachelor Buttons, Coreopsis, Verbena, Chinese Forget Me Nots, Sunflowers, Seed Dahlias, Cosmos, Zinnias, Purple and Pink Hyssop, Celosia, Marigolds, Irish Poets, Canterbury Bells, bells of Ireland, Larkspur, California Poppies, moss rose, Rudbeckia, and Kiss Me Over the Garden Gate.

Perennials: Daylilies, Lambs Ear, Ajuga, Swamp Milkweed, Orange Milkweed, Yarrow, Sea Holly, Mums, Sempervivums, Sedum, Snapdragons, Columbine, Lavender, Sage, Thyme, Hibiscus, Shasta Daisy, Salvia, Nepeta, Echinacea, Italian Bugloss, Dwarf Twinkle Phlox, and Morning Glory.

Their main yard:

Trees: Apple, Peach, Apricot, Pear, Plumb, Cherry, blueberries, Magnolia, Maple, Weeping Pussy Willow, Weeping Pear, English Midland Hawthorn, Serviceberry, Crabapple

Bushes: Forsythia, Burning Bush, Lavender (2), Hydrangea (5), Crepe Myrtle (2), Hibiscus Hedge, Rose (8), Clematis (3)

Perennials: Daylily (2), Veronica (2), Iris, Peony (3), Allium, Anemone, Delphinium, Zebra Grass, Porcupine Grass, Potentilla, Foxglove, campanula, dianthus, phlox, ice plant, alyssum

Bulbs: Tulips, Hyacinths, Snakehead Fritillary, Liatris, English Bluebells, Tiger and Asiatic Lilys
